Chapter 91: Failure to resist the decree

Xie Zhaozhao's Wangyue Tower was a bit far away from the front hall. By the time she had sorted herself out, Mrs. Yu, her second wife Dou and Xie Xingchen had already arrived.

Yu's expression was calm.

After all, if you receive too many imperial edicts, there is nothing to be afraid of.

Dou and Xie Xingchen were completely uneasy.

Seeing Xie Zhaozhao come in, Mrs. Yu greeted her, "Come over to my mother."

Xie Wei had just come down from court and was standing in the hall.

When everyone arrived, he ordered the incense table to be set up, thanked Wei and asked the eunuch to come forward.

The whole family knelt down neatly.

The father-in-law who delivered the decree had a high-pitched voice: "By God, the emperor has issued an edict that Xie Xingchen, the legitimate daughter of the Xie family, is a virtuous, virtuous and outstandingly beautiful woman. She has been specially given to marry Wang Liang's concubine Wei, and they will get married on a certain day. I admire this."

"What?" Xie Xingchen's face changed suddenly, he completely forgot about the occasion and exclaimed, "Why do you want me to marry-"

Mrs. Dou was also stunned.

But at the critical moment, he pulled Xie Xingchen's sleeve hard and smiled stiffly at the eunuch who was delivering the order.

Yu was extremely shocked.

Only Xie Wei and Xie Zhaozhao in the family looked calm.

The eunuch who delivered the order looked down at the pale Xie Xingchen, "Is this the second concubine's concubine? His Royal Highness Prince Liang is one of the most popular among the people and is the pillar of the imperial court. I don't know how many noble ladies want to marry into Prince Liang's palace as a concubine. Not yet. Here’s this opportunity.”

"You, you have such a happy marriage because of the favor of the Holy One. Why don't you hurry up and accept the decree to express your gratitude?"

Xie Xingchen almost broke his silver teeth.

Who is a dragon or a phoenix, a pillar of the imperial court?

Prince Liang is already in his 30s and has married several princesses over the years, all of whom were short-lived.

There are rumors among the people that he killed too many people and his evil spirit was so strong that he suppressed his wife.

Moreover, there are already three concubines in Prince Liang's palace, as well as many concubines. The number of women is terrifying.

What kind of happy marriage is she marrying Prince Liang?
"Why are you still standing there?" The eunuch who delivered the order narrowed his eyes, "Do you want to resist the order?"

Xie Xingchen was excited, and under Dou's eyes, she accepted the imperial edict with great reluctance, "Thank you, Lord, for your kindness."

The eunuch who delivered the message withdrew his gaze and helped Xie Wei up: "Congratulations, Mr. Guo. Now that you are married to Prince Liang, you can be considered a relative of the emperor."

"What are you talking about, father-in-law? Please come into the inner hall to serve tea." Xie Wei said politely.

The father-in-law who delivered the decree did not refuse, and pulled Xie Wei in, talking and laughing.

Xie Zhaozhao knew in his heart that Xie Wei probably wanted to take care of the father-in-law, so that he would not displease Emperor Xuanwu when he went back to mention the situation when Xie Xingchen received the order.

At the same time, you should also inquire about the Holy Will.

Xie Wei has always been able to handle these matters with ease and does not need to worry too much.

Xie Zhaozhao looked away and looked at Xie Xingchen, whose face was pale and holding the imperial edict in his hand, wanting to tear it to pieces on the spot. She smiled and said: "Congratulations, second sister, you flew up the branch and became the princess. This is incredible."

Xie Xingchen glared at Xie Zhaozhao with great anger.

Xie Zhaozhao stepped forward and held her wrist, "The people who delivered the order haven't left yet."

"If they see you so unhappy and tell the Emperor, the Emperor will be furious and may die."

Xie Xingchen was stiff all over.

The usually weak face was now covered with frost, as if he wished he could kill Xie Zhaozhao on the spot.

Mrs. Yu has recovered from the shock, "Okay, go back to Yilan Garden and stay well. You have to go to the palace tomorrow to thank me."

Dou and Xie Xingchen could only suppress all the depression and anger in their hearts and left with stiff backs.

Yu frowned and said, "What's going on..."

Xie Zhaozhao did not answer, only lowered his eyes.

The child really belonged to Prince Liang, and she and Yun Qi had guessed it right.

……

This decree of marriage was beyond everyone's expectations.Some people felt that King Liang was not a good match, while others felt that the Xie family had climbed into the royal family, and they were very envious.

Xie Zhaozhao made people pay attention to the situation in Yilan Garden at all times, and also made people pay attention to the news in the palace.

Xianggui said: "We can keep an eye on Yilan Garden, but it's not easy to find out the news in the palace."

In the previous dynasty, there were eunuchs who caused trouble, so after Emperor Xuanwu ascended the throne, he sent people to clean up the palace, and anyone who casually passed on news would be executed with a cane.

Anyone who inquires about palace information will also have their entire family exiled.

Severe punishments and harsh laws make people dare not even take a single step across the pond.

It is almost impossible to have an informant in the palace.

Xie Zhaozhao frowned slightly.

Xianggui looked at her for a while and whispered: "Otherwise, let's go to Miaoshan Hall and ask there."

"..."

Xie Zhaozhao glanced at her.

Xianggui laughed quickly: "Aren't you curious about the palace? The people there must know best. I heard that His Highness now goes to the palace to stay with the Holy Master every day, spending an hour or two at a time."

"Besides, Miss has not seen His Highness for some time..."

Xianggui takes personal care of Xie Zhaozhao, and naturally knows the subtleties between Xie Zhaozhao and Yun Qi.

To be honest, I am very happy to see the results.

His Royal Highness King Dingxi is more reliable than Chu Nanxuan and more suitable for young ladies.

"That's all you know." Xie Zhaozhao said lightly, holding the handkerchief and wiping the Frost Moon Sword in his hand, "Then come over in the afternoon."

"Okay, I'll tell you to prepare the carriage." Xianggui asked, "Can you bring something to His Highness?"

Xie Zhaozhao asked: "What do you want to bring?"

"It's not that I want to..." Xiang Gui said speechlessly: "It's that the young lady wants to... You and His Highness haven't seen each other for a few days. It's better to go find out the news when we meet. You have to give people some benefits. Why don't you go empty-handed?"

Xie Zhaozhao paused and said, "That's true."

What to bring?

She thought for a while, then put the Frost Moon Sword on the shelf, "Let's go out now to Nanshi Street."

Yun Qi likes to eat the sugar-roasted chestnuts sold by an old couple on Nanshi Street the most, so it’s a good idea to bring this.

Because he was going to see Yun Qi and it was not easy to show off on horseback, Xie Zhaozhao still traveled by carriage.

After getting off the bus at Nanshijiekou, we went straight to the stall selling chestnuts.

The old couple's business was good today. When Xie Zhaozhao arrived, there happened to be only one portion of roasted chestnuts left, which the old couple left for their grandson.

Seeing that Xie Zhaozhao was kind and offered double the money, the two of them generously sold it to Xie Zhaozhao.

After carrying the chestnuts, Xie Zhaozhao went straight to Miaoshan Hall.

As soon as the shopkeeper saw Xie Zhaozhao, he sensibly led him along the small door to the Dingxi Prince's Mansion and sent him all the way to Han Yuexuan.

The lady in charge of Han Yuexuan, whose surname was Li, ordered someone to serve tea and cakes to Xie Zhaozhao, and said respectfully: "I will step back now. Miss, if you need anything, please call me again."

"it is good."

Xie Zhaozhao nodded.

She put the chestnuts on the table and sat down to wait for Yun Qi.

After waiting and waiting, it was getting dark and Yun Qi hadn't come back yet. Xie Zhaozhao himself became sleepy. After reading a book for a while, he fell asleep on the table.

I don’t know how long I slept when I felt someone moving me.

Xie Zhaozhao suddenly sat up and opened his eyes.

Yun Qi originally bent down to carry her to the bed, but he didn't expect to wake her up.

If he hadn't reacted quickly enough to dodge, he would have been hit in the face by the back of her head.

Looking at the darkness outside, Xie Zhaozhao said: "I'm back!"
